St. Thomas Public School (Oxford Public school)

One of the older schools of Bangalore located in Indira Nagar is St. Thomas Public School. It was earlier called Oxford Public School.

Syllabus: ICSE
Fees: About 40K per year( not sure ,will update soon)

Location: 32, New Thippasandra, Church Street
Indira Nagar, Bangalore- 560075
Phone: 080-25282890

Second language: Kannada, Hindi
Class Strength: about 75-80
Extra-curricular activities: Wide range of activities, after school hours.

Remark: Since the school's been there for a long time, there are is more intake. Kindergarten teaching is good, not sure how they manage with a huge strength. Tests are conducted periodically (3 unit tests in a term) . Three language system from class 1 onwards.

  21. OK the pros:-

    (1) An almost amazing level of academic education (surefire 90% above result; with the exception of those deranged by IQ; anyone else, teachers WILL elevate you to great results)
    (2)Untiring efforts from teachers (they DO NOT give up on students or leave even a microscopic portion of the syllabus UNTAUGHT; VERY UNLIKE some schools where teachers leave whole chapters incomplete).
    (3) Good "Atmosphere" ; this school ensures a decent adherence of students to "moral code", so don't worry about your wards deviating from the right path (no sarcasm intended).

    The Cons:

    (1) Poor infrastructure yada-yada-yada; must have got enough of that already.
    (2) Poor Physical activity; class 7 gets about 1 pt/week and high school gets NONE!! Even though there's no ground (u must hav heard about that already) i think they can step up the no. of PT classes.
    (3) Sometimes (mostly in high school) teachers enjoy getting under students' skins over trivial issues.
    (4) The school should really loosen up on the boy-girl-barrier mantra. Not too much, just the present extremism of the situation can be extinguished.


    WELL, there you have it: the + and - of St. Thomas....(though some may say the pain outweighs the prize) I'll say it's a good school if you're looking for brilliant results, excellent ICSE education and a good moral base.

    And I am of course, a product of St. Thoams
